Here are the Top 50 prospect defensemen to own in your points-only keeper leagues – February edition!

Some movement at the top end again, as with the Top 200 Prospect Forwards. But this time we have a new number one! Adam Boqvist is showing that he’s just not ready to contribute points to fantasy teams this year, and not providing much hope that he will do so next season either. That year-and-a-half wait impacts his overall value and sinks him a bit. Meanwhile, Ty Smith is putting up points like nobody’s business. Can he be on my team please?

As always, players rated within +/- 5.0 ratings of each other should be considered equal value and at that point are a matter of team need (i.e. can wait or need help now, versus high upside, versus NHL certainty) or personal bias.
